Crypto exchange Binance has announced it will no longer support four altcoins — BarnBridge (BOND), Dock (DOCK), Mdex (MDX), and Polkastar (POLS). Effective July 22 at 03:00 UTC, it will delist these altcoins, causing a sharp drop in their market value.

This price action reflects market sensitivity to exchange delistings and regulatory actions.

Altcoins Nosedive Following Binance Delisting AnnouncementImmediately following the announcement, the affected tokens saw significant price declines. Specifically, DOCK plummeted nearly 30%, MDX dropped by 23.65%, and BOND and POLS both experienced over 17% losses.

The delistings are part of Binance’s periodic review. Often, it adds the tokens under the monitoring tag before delisting them. For instance, on July 1, Binance included 11 altcoins under its monitoring tag, including DOCK and POLS.

“At Binance, we periodically review each digital asset we list to ensure that it continues to meet a high level of standard and industry requirements,” Binance explained.

BOND, DOCK, MDX, and POLS Price Performance. Source: TradingViewThe review focuses on several critical factors, such as the project team’s commitment, trading volume, liquidity, network security, and responsiveness to due diligence inquiries.

Trading pairs like BOND/BTC, BOND/USDT, DOCK/BTC, DOCK/USDT, MDX/USDT, and POLS/USDT will see a trading halt, and all existing trade orders will be automatically removed after delisting. Users must withdraw these tokens by October 22, 2024. If not, Binance might convert the delisted tokens into stablecoins, although this is not guaranteed and will be subject to a future notification.

Furthermore, Binance is making adjustments across various services to phase out these altcoins comprehensively. These changes include delisting from Binance Simple Earn and Auto-Invest, ending margin trading for these tokens, and removing them from Binance Convert and Binance Pay by predetermined dates.

In a blog post on Tuesday, Binance Exchange, the largest crypto trading platform by volume, announced the automatic conversion of several delisted tokens to USDC.

This action will be executed based on the average token to USDC exchange rate within the conversion period.

What Binance Exchange Users Need To KnowAfter delisting 10 tokens from its catalog, Binance said in a follow-up message that it would convert them to USDC automatically, enabling holders to access their funds. After the conversion happens, the exchange will credit the stablecoin equivalent of the affected tokens to users’ wallets by April 28, 2025. The tokens include:

Holders of these tokens should adjust their trading strategies accordingly to prepare for the upcoming changes. Failure to do so by October 28 would see them automatically converted to USDC, effectively phasing out the affected tokens from the exchange.

“During the Conversion Period [between October 29, 2024 and April 28, 2025], users will not be able to view the above tokens in their Binance wallets,” Binance articulated.

In this regard, it is worth mentioning that the history of Binance’s tokens delisting often inspires volatility. For instance, the exchange delisted six altcoins around mid-August, causing double-digit price drops for PowerPool (CVP) and Ellipsis (EPX). These tokens also featured among the delisted assets.

However, Binance is not only removing several tokens but also adding new ones to its platform. One of the notable additions is Scroll (SCR), a zkRollup scaling solution for Ethereum.

As per the announcement, SCR will be listed on October 11, with pre-market trading for the SCR/USDT pair set to open. This move supports Ethereum’s scalability by enabling faster, more efficient transactions while maintaining security and decentralization.

“Binance is excited to announce the 60th project on Binance Launchpool – Scroll (SCR), a Bytecode-level compatible zkEVM Rollup,” an excerpt in Binance’s announcement read.

With this listing notice, Binance becomes the first platform to list Scroll’s powering token. The exchange will also airdrop 55,000,000 SCR, representing 5.5% of the total supply. Airdrop farming will start on Wednesday, October 9. The participants must lock their BNB and FDUSD to receive the SCR tokens.
